Indian Navy SSR Medical Recruitment 2026 Salary ₹69,100
The Indian Navy SSR Medical Recruitment 2026 notification invites applications for the SSR (Medical) branch in the Indian Navy. This recruitment is open for 12th pass candidates with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ology (PCB) who want to join the Indian Navy medical branch and start a career in defence services.
Selected candidates will receive a training stipend of ₹14,600 per month, and after training they will be placed in Level 3 of the Defence Pay Matrix with a salary of ₹21,700 – ₹69,100, along with Military Service Pay (MSP) and other allowances.

Indian Navy SSR Medical Salary and Pay Scale
Indian Navy SSR Medical Recruitment 2026 salary structure offers a stable defence government job with a fixed pay scale, allowances, and long-term career growth in the Indian Navy medical branch.
Training Period Pay
Stipend during training: ₹14,600 per month
Salary After Training
Level 3 of Defence Pay Matrix
Salary: ₹21,700 – ₹69,100
Additional benefits include :
Military Service Pay (MSP): ₹5200 per month
Dearness Allowance (DA) as applicable
Promotion Opportunities
Career growth is available up to:
Master Chief Petty Officer-I
Pay scale: ₹47,600 – ₹1,51,100

Eligibility Criteria for Indian Navy
Eligibility Criteria for Indian Navy SSR Medical Recruitment 2026 includes requirements related to 10+2 PCB qualification, minimum marks, age limit, and marital status. Candidates must meet these Indian Navy SSR Medical eligibility conditions before applying online.
10+2 with Physics, Chemistry and Biology (PCB)
From a recognized board of education
Minimum 50% aggregate marks
Minimum 40% marks in each subject
Students appearing in the Class 12 board exam (2025–26 session) are also eligible to apply. They must produce the original marksheet during later stages of recruitment.
Age Limit
01 May 2005 to 31 October 2009 (both dates inclusive)
Marital Status
Only unmarried male candidates are eligible to apply.

Indian Navy SSR Medical Exam Pattern
Indian Navy SSR Medical Exam Pattern helps candidates understand the INET exam structure, subjects, marking scheme, and duration before appearing for the recruitment test.
Stage 1 – INET Exam
Mode: Computer-based test
Total Questions: 100
Marks per Question: 1
Duration: 1 hour
Subjects included : English, Science, Biology, General Awareness
Negative Marking : 0.25 marks

Physical Fitness Test (PFT)
Candidates shortlisted for the next stage must qualify the Indian Navy SSR Medical Physical Fitness Test (PFT). The required standards are given below
Since the Indian Navy SSR Medical PFT standards require endurance and strength, candidates should regularly practice running, bodyweight exercises, and core workouts to comfortably meet these requirements during the recruitment process.
| Test | Requirement |
|---|---|
| 1.6 km run | 6 min 30 sec |
| Squats (Uthak Baithak) | 20 |
| Push-ups | 15 |
| Bent Knee Sit-ups | 15 |
